MOURAO XAVIER GOMES, Ludmila et al. Knowledge and practice of breast self-examination by academic nursing. Rev Cubana Enfermer [online]. 2012, vol.28, n.4, pp.465-473. ISSN 0864-0319.

Background: the self-examination possibilities evaluation and early detection of alterations breast. Besides, it does not replace physical exam performed by the qualified health professional for this activity. The realization frequency influences directly the accuracy method and stimulates the self-care. Objective: verify if the female nursing undergraduate students performed the breast self-examination. Method: this is a descriptive study with cross-sectional approach, performed in undergraduate degree nursing located in the city of Montes Claros, Minas Gerais, Brazil. The subjects were 202 female nursing undergraduate students from the private institution of higher education. The collect tool was the structured questionnaire elaborated by the own researchers and validated in pilot study. The project was submitted to appreciation and approved by the Research Ethic Committee. Results: it was showed the most of participants said do not perform periodically the breast self-examination. The most information resource was the internet, television and faculty. Among the participants, the most affirmed already have got the information. The main barrier was forgetfulness and do not know the correct technique. Conclusion: it is recommended to rethink ways of teaching-learning the subject in universities, in pursuit of meaningful learning and for women; future nurse may take responsibility for their health and understand their role as a caretaker from the prevention of breast cancer and assuming self-care.
